Understanding KiwiSaver and Its Importance
KiwiSaver is a voluntary, work-based savings initiative designed to help New Zealanders save for retirement. Introduced in 2007, it combines contributions from both employees and employers, along with government incentives, to build a retirement fund over time. As New Zealand faces a growing aging population, the importance of KiwiSaver becomes increasingly evident. Many individuals are realizing the need for a robust retirement savings plan, and KiwiSaver serves as a foundational pillar for this.

Identifying Sustainable KiwiSaver Funds
When exploring sustainable options within the KiwiSaver landscape, the first step is to identify funds that prioritize environmental, social, and governance (ESG) criteria. Many KiwiSaver providers now offer funds that specifically focus on sustainable investing. These funds typically exclude investments in sectors like fossil fuels, tobacco, and weapons, while promoting companies that focus on renewable energy, sustainable agriculture, and ethical practices.
The process of selecting a sustainable KiwiSaver fund can begin by researching various fund providers. Look for those that publish detailed information about their investment strategies, including how they integrate ESG considerations into their decision-making processes. Transparent reporting and regular updates on sustainability performance are also essential indicators of a fund’s commitment to sustainable investing. Evaluating Fund Performance and Impact
Choosing a sustainable KiwiSaver fund involves more than just assessing financial returns; it’s crucial to evaluate the fund’s impact as well. Many funds that prioritize sustainable investing often perform competitively with traditional funds. However, the real value lies in how these funds contribute to societal and environmental goals.
Investors should look for funds that provide metrics on their sustainability impact, such as carbon footprint reduction, community investment, or contributions to gender equality. Some funds might even offer impact reports that detail the positive changes their investments have facilitated. As you evaluate potential funds, consider both their past performance and their future sustainability goals. The Role of Government and Regulation in Sustainable Investing
The New Zealand government plays a significant role in promoting sustainable investing through various initiatives and regulations. The introduction of the Sustainable Finance Forum aims to enhance the financial sector’s contribution to sustainable outcomes. This aligns with global trends toward responsible investing and acknowledges the growing demand for transparency in how funds are managed.
KiwiSaver providers are increasingly required to disclose their investment strategies and the associated risks, including those related to climate change. This regulatory framework encourages providers to adopt sustainable practices and offer funds that align with the principles of responsible investing.
